In his address, the deputy noted that increasing the share of small and medium-sized businesses in GDP is necessary for sustainable economic development.

To achieve this goal, according to Sukharev, it is necessary not only to create preferential tax and credit conditions for business, but also to simplify the procedure for registering new enterprises.

“In this regard, I ask you to evaluate the expediency of exemption from payment of state duties for citizens who register a legal entity for the first time or register for the first time as individual entrepreneurs,” the text of the appeal says.

Currently, the amount of fees is 4 thousand rubles for registration of a legal entity and 800 rubles for registration of an individual entrepreneur.

Today only persons who have submitted documents for registration in electronic form and have a personal enhanced qualified electronic signature can not pay these fees.
